F351 RTP is a 1989 Volkswagen Caravelle in White with a 1,915c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 29 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 65.5%.

Across all 1989 Volkswagen Caravelle models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.2% with a typical mileage of 113,804 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Volkswagen Caravelle fails its MOT is registration plate lamp not working, accounting for 8,177 recorded failures. If you're considering buying F351 RTP,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Volkswagen Caravelle typically stays on UK roads for around 43 years. At 37 years old, this Volkswagen Caravelle is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
